Output b12dfa900b723624dd8e854417535e5f97b7a086d2f866dbfe16aa1f7fe98732:21

value
13257905
script pubkey
OP_0 OP_PUSHBYTES_20 85c4ac37de95b3f26ca30efa2246674a4f9f26ab
address
bc1qshz2cd77jkelym9rpmazy3n8ff8e7f4t6w5su3
transaction
b12dfa900b723624dd8e854417535e5f97b7a086d2f866dbfe16aa1f7fe98732
spent
true